Characterization of Waste Sludge Pigment from Production of ZnCl2

Abstract: This study is focused on the treatment of waste sludge from a zinc chloride production in order to prepare iron-rich pigments usable for a production of glazes. In galvanizing plants,, yellow waste sludge containing significant amount of ZnO, Cl, and Fe2O3, is formed. This raw waste sludge cannot be used as a pigment in glaze. Therefore, three methods of treating this material were proposed: a) washing with H2O, b) calcination at 180 °C and washing by H2O, and c) calcination at 900 °C and washing by H2O. These… Show more
